Overview

CVE-2002-0223 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ting infopop ultimate_bulletin_board. It was published on May 16, 2002 and has a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5 (HIGH).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5, rated HIGH. It can be exploited remotely over the network.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

Infopop UBB.Threads 5.4 and Wired Community Software WWWThreads 5.0 through 5.0.9 allows remote attackers to upload arbitrary files by using a filename that contains an accepted extension, but ends in a different extension.
